Vidyasagar Potdar is a scholar working on Information Systems,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Computer Networks and Communications. According to data from OpenAlex, Vidyasagar Potdar has authored 122 papers receiving a total of 3.0k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 45 papers in Information Systems, 38 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ering and 35 papers in Computer Networks and Communications. Recurrent topics in Vidyasagar Potdar's work include Spam and Phishing Detection (18 papers), Smart Grid Energy Management (17 papers) and Advanced Steganography and Watermarking Techniques (14 papers). Vidyasagar Potdar is often cited by papers focused on Spam and Phishing Detection (18 papers), Smart Grid Energy Management (17 papers) and Advanced Steganography and Watermarking Techniques (14 papers). Vidyasagar Potdar collaborates with scholars based in Australia, India and Indonesia. Vidyasagar Potdar's co-authors include Elizabeth Chang, Atif Sharif, Song Han, A. J. Dinusha Rathnayaka, Tharam S. Dillon, Chen Wu, Omar Khadeer Hussain, Michele John, Ketan Kotecha and Alex Talevski and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, IEEE Access and Sustainability.
